H2: The Benefits of Italian Citizenship

The allure of Italian citizenship extends beyond simply holding a European passport. Benefits include:

  • Visa-free travel within the Schengen Area: Explore Europe with ease.
  • Right to live and work in any EU country: Open up career opportunities across the continent.
  • Access to EU social benefits: Depending on your residency, you may be eligible for various social security and healthcare benefits.
  • Cultural Connection: Reconnect with your heritage and explore the rich culture and history of Italy.
